Why Antibacterial Materials Are Essential for Dishwashers

Hygiene Challenges in Dishwasher Usage

  • Plastic Liners: Exposed to food residues and water, creating breeding grounds for bacteria.
  • Door Trims and Seals: Constant exposure to moisture leads to microbial buildup.
  • Buttons and Switches: High-touch areas prone to bacterial contamination.
  • Metal Surface Coatings: Susceptible to bacteria and stains, compromising aesthetics and hygiene.

Risks of Using Traditional Materials

  • Bacterial Growth: Causes foul odors and hygiene concerns.
  • Mold Formation: Degrades seals, leading to leaks and reduced efficiency.
  • Frequent Cleaning: Increases maintenance costs without ensuring long-term protection.
